Assume that <math>q(\mu,\tau) = q(\mu)q(\tau)</math>, i.e. that the posterior distribution factorizes into independent factors for <math>\mu</math> and <math>\tau</math>. This type of assumption underlies the variational Bayesian method. The true posterior distribution does not in fact factor this way (in fact, in this simple case, it is known to be a [[Gaussian-gamma distribution]]), and hence the result we obtain will be an approximation.
